手机如何保存配置文件JSON:实用方法与技巧
在移动应用开发或日常使用中,JSON(JavaScript Object Notation)作为一种轻量级的数据交换格式,常被用于存储配置信息、用户数据或应用设置,手机端保存JSON配置文件的需求很常见,无论是开发者调试应用,还是普通用户备份个性化设置,都需要正确的方法,本文将详细介绍手机中保存JSON配置文件的多种方式,从内置工具到第三方应用,帮助你高效管理和存储JSON文件。
手机自带文件管理器保存:基础直接的方法
对于大多数智能手机(如安卓、iOS),系统自带的文件管理器是保存JSON文件最基础的工具,无需额外安装应用,适合临时存储或简单管理。
安卓手机操作步骤
-
创建JSON文件:
- 打开手机自带的“文件管理”应用(不同品牌手机名称可能略有差异,如“我的文件”、“文件”等)。
- 进入目标存储位置(如“内部存储”或插入的SD卡),点击“新建”或“+”号,选择“文本文件”或“空文件”。
- 命名文件时以
.json如config.json),系统会自动识别为JSON格式。
-
编辑并保存JSON内容:
- 点击打开新建的JSON文件,若系统未自带编辑功能,可复制JSON内容后粘贴到备忘录或笔记应用中修改,再返回文件管理器长按文件选择“编辑”,粘贴后保存。
- 部分安卓文件管理器(如三星“我的文件”)支持直接点击文件进入简易编辑模式,修改后右上角点击“保存”即可。
iPhone/iPad操作步骤
-
使用“文件”App创建文件:
- 打开系统自带的“文件”App,进入“我的iPhone”或“iCloud云盘”,点击右上角“浏览”旁的“…”号,选择“新建文件夹”(可选)或直接点击“创建”选择“空白文件”。
- 命名文件并添加
.json后缀(如settings.json),点击“存储”。
-
编辑JSON内容:
- 点击打开文件,若内容为空,可直接输入JSON数据;若已有内容,可长按选择文本进行修改。
- iPhone默认可能没有强大的JSON编辑功能,建议通过“备忘录”App先编写JSON内容(可配合语法高亮插件),再复制粘贴到“文件”App的JSON文件中,保存后覆盖原文件。
优点:无需额外安装应用,系统自带,操作简单;缺点:编辑功能较弱,适合临时保存,不适合频繁修改或复杂JSON结构。
使用代码编辑器App:开发者与进阶用户的首选
如果你需要频繁编辑JSON文件(如开发者调试API接口、修改应用配置),安装专业的代码编辑器App能大幅提升效率,支持语法高亮、自动补全、错误提示等功能。
推荐安卓代码编辑器App
- Acode:免费开源的代码编辑器,支持JSON、HTML、Python等多种语言,内置文件管理器,可直接创建、编辑、保存JSON文件,并通过FTP/SFTP连接服务器上传文件。
- VS Code Mobile:微软出品的移动端编辑器,与桌面版同步,支持Git集成、插件扩展(如JSON Schema验证),适合需要多设备协作的开发者。
- JSON Editor:轻量级专用JSON工具,支持实时语法校验、格式化(压缩/美化)、JSON转XML等功能,操作简单,适合非专业用户快速处理JSON。
推荐iOS代码编辑器App
- Koder Code Editor:支持JSON、JavaScript、CSS等语言,内置SSH客户端,可远程编辑服务器上的JSON文件,适合开发者使用。
- Textastic:功能强大的代码编辑器,支持语法高亮、代码折叠、自定义主题,可通过iCloud、Dropbox等云服务同步文件,跨设备编辑体验佳。
- JSON Viewer & Editor:专注于JSON处理的工具,支持JSON树形结构展示、语法错误提示、数据导出(CSV/Excel),适合需要分析JSON数据的用户。
操作示例(以Acode为例):
- 打开Acode,点击“+新建”选择“文件”,命名
config.json并保存; - 点击文件进入编辑界面,输入JSON内容(如
{"theme": "dark", "language": "zh"}),编辑完成后点击右上角“保存”或“导出”; - 可通过“打开方式”分享给其他应用,或直接上传到云端存储。
优点:功能专业,支持高复杂度JSON编辑,适合开发者;缺点:部分应用需付费或学习成本。
通过云端存储服务同步:跨设备与备份优选
如果你需要在手机、电脑、平板等多设备间同步JSON配置文件,或担心手机丢失导致文件丢失,使用云端存储服务(如百度网盘、阿里云盘、iCloud、Google Drive)是最稳妥的方式。
操作步骤(以百度网盘为例)
-
保存JSON文件到云端:
- 在手机文件管理器中创建好JSON文件后,打开百度网盘App,点击“上传”选择“文件”,找到JSON文件上传。
- 上传后,可在“我的网盘”中创建专属文件夹(如“JSON配置文件”),将文件归类管理。
-
跨设备同步与编辑:
- 在电脑端登录百度网盘网页版,可直接下载JSON文件到本地,用VS Code、Sublime Text等桌面编辑器修改后重新上传,手机端会自动同步最新版本。
- 部分云端服务(如Google Drive)支持在线编辑JSON文件,无需下载到本地,修改后自动保存。
iOS用户专属:iCloud云盘
- iPhone用户可直接将JSON文件保存到“文件”App的iCloud云盘,登录同一Apple ID的iPad/Mac可实时同步,且iCloud会自动备份文件,防止数据丢失。
优点:跨设备同步、自动备份、数据安全;缺点:依赖网络,部分服务有存储空间限制。
利用备忘录/笔记应用:轻量级存储与快速编辑
对于结构简单、内容较少的JSON配置文件(如用户个人设置、API密钥等),使用手机备忘录或笔记应用(如安卓“备忘录”、iPhone“备忘录”、印象笔记、OneNote)保存更便捷,支持富文本编辑和标签分类。
操作技巧
-
直接保存JSON文本:
- 打开备忘录App,新建笔记,粘贴JSON内容,标题可命名为
config.json(方便搜索),保存后笔记内容即为JSON数据。 - 部分备忘录支持导出为文件(如iPhone“备忘录”点击“分享”选择“存储到‘文件’”),可导出为
.json格式,兼顾编辑与文件管理。
- 打开备忘录App,新建笔记,粘贴JSON内容,标题可命名为
-
结合标签分类管理:
为JSON配置笔记添加标签(如“#配置文件”“#API设置”),通过标签快速查找,避免大量笔记中翻找。
优点:操作极简,适合轻量级JSON,支持富文本和标签;缺点:不适合大文件或复杂JSON结构,导出为文件需额外步骤。
开发者专用:手机端编程工具保存JSON
对于移动端开发者,可能需要在手机上直接编写代码并生成JSON配置文件(如动态生成接口响应数据、调试应用配置),手机端的编程工具或在线代码编辑器是最佳选择。
推荐工具
- Pydroid 3(安卓):Python IDE,支持运行Python脚本生成JSON数据,可将结果保存为文件(如通过
json.dump()写入.json文件),并通过文件管理器查看。 - Pythonista(iOS):功能强大的Python开发环境,支持JSON数据处理、图形界面开发,生成的JSON文件可直接保存到“文件”App或iCloud云盘。
- OnlineGDB(在线编辑器):手机浏览器访问在线编程平台(如onlinegdb.com),支持编写C、C++、Python等代码,生成JSON数据后复制保存到本地文件。
操作示例(Pydroid 3生成JSON):
import json
config = {"app_name": "Weather", "version": "1.0", "units": "metric"}
with open("/storage/emulated/0/Download/config.json", "w") as f:
json.dump(config, f, indent=4)
print("JSON文件已保存到Download目录")
运行脚本后,文件管理器的“Download”文件夹会生成config.json文件。
优点:适合开发者动态生成JSON,支持编程逻辑处理;缺点:需要一定编程基础,普通用户使用门槛高。
注意事项:JSON文件保存的常见问题与解决
- 文件格式错误:
JSON语法要求



还没有评论,来说两句吧...